问题描述
|
在.NET 4.0中将sqlite 1.0.66与NHibernate 3一起使用会显示此错误:
无法从NHibernate.Driver.sqlite20Driver创建驱动程序。
我尝试过:
<startup useLegacyV2RuntimeActivationPolicy=\"true\">
<supportedRuntime version=\"v4.0\" />
</startup>
尝试将文件手动复制到调试文件夹。
有什么帮助吗?
Tks []
帕特里克·科埃略
解决方法
如果您使用的是Win7-64位,则可能是System.Data.SQLite.DLL的32位/ 64位版本问题。
如果将程序编译为32bitOnly并使用System.Data.SQLite.DLL的32位版本,则程序可以正常工作吗?